When selecting the right recycling partner in Marion, we recommend looking for businesses that offer secure data destruction, convenient pickup services for bulky items, and maintain industry certifications. Electronics recycling in Marion helps recover valuable materials, reduces landfill waste, and prevents toxic substances from contaminating local soil and groundwater.
Before You Go
Remove personal data, call ahead to confirm accepted items and hours. North Carolina requires proper e-waste disposal - never put electronics in regular trash.
